Follow These Steps to Install or Upgrade Windows:
Decide which version of windows you want to install and have the product key for that particular version. You can get the product key from the sticker on your computer or in an email from Microsoft if you have purchased the key digitally.
Go to the website of Microsoft and download the windows installation media. Select whether you want to download the 32-bit or 64-bit version, depending on your computer’s hardware.
- Create a DVD from the windows installation media.
- Put this DVD in your system and restart it.
- Press the key (usually, these are F12, F10, or Esc, depending on your computer) for the boot menu to start as soon as your computer starts up. Select “boot” from DVD.
- Now follow the instructions as given and upgrade your windows. When prompted, enter the product key.
- Follow the on-screen instructions for further completing the installation.

Alternative Method
On your system, click “start.” Go to “settings,” “system,” and then “activation.”
You will be able to see whether you are using the home edition or pro one in addition to if you are activated under the activation state.
After clicking “Activation,” select “Change product key” and then enter it. Select “Next” to upgrade the windows.
